GM Small Block Engines - 2007 Crate Motor Buyers Guide
| IRON L92 CRATE ENGINE | | COMPANY: | Late Model Engines | | BLOCK: | 6.0L, iron, new | | DISPLACEMENT: | 408ci (6.7L) | | COMPRESSION RATIO: | 11.75:1 | | CRANKSHAFT: | 4.000-inch, Callies Compstar, 4340 forged steel | | RODS: | 6.125-inch, Callies Compstar, 4340 forged steel, H-beam | | PISTONS: | 4.030-inch, Wiseco, custom forged nitrous with L92 | | | valve pockets, .300-inch material above top ring land | | RINGS: | NPR stainless chrome; 1.2, 1.2, 3mm (for high-heat | | | applications) | | ROD BEARINGS: | Clevite MS 2199 H | | MAIN BEARINGS: | Clevite CB 663 H | | CAM BEARINGS: | DuraBond CH-23 | | BOLTS: | ARP main studs, head studs, and 2000 7/16 rod bolts | | HEADS: | GM L92, aluminum, 2.165/1.600-inch Manley one-piece stainless steel valves, fully ported and polished with competition valve job | | HEAD GASKETS: | Cometic MLS | | CAM: | Cam Motion, hydraulic roller, 257/266 duration at .050, .646/.638-inch lift | | LIFTERS: | COMP Cams 850-16 | | PUSHRODS: | COMP Cams one-piece chrome-moly | | ROCKER ARMS: | GM with Harland Sharp trunnion modification | | VALVESPRINGS: | Manley NexTek, dual | | INTAKE MANIFOLD: | GM L76 | | THROTTLE BODY: | GM LS2 | | FUEL INJECTORS: | GM, 40-pound | | MAF: | no | | WIRING HARNESS: | no | | PCM: | no | | CORE CHARGES: | no | | WARRANTY: | 6 months | | PRICE: | $9,199.00 | | COMMENTS: | Heads flow 357 cfm intake and 240 cfm exhaust at 28 inches of water. L92 long-blocks can be orderedwith any compression ratio. Custom camshaft for specific application, upgraded ARP L19 head studs,billet main caps, O-ring and receiver groove, and L92aluminum blocks are all available. LME offers cylinderheads from AFR, ET Performance, and Trick Flow. |
